India’s major gas retailer Indian Oil Corp will marginally reduce petrol and diesel costs from Tuesday, in accordance to a notification sent to dealers, reflecting a decrease in global oil prices.

A liter of petrol in New Delhi will expense 96.32 rupees  ($1.16), although diesel will be bought at 89.24 rupees, the notification confirmed. At present, a liter of petrol is marketed at 96.72 rupees and a liter of diesel at 89.62 rupees.

Indian point out fuel retailers IOC, Bharat Petroleum Corp, and Hindustan Petroleum Corp dominate the community gas product sales market and shift prices in tandem. The companies could not be attained for comment outdoors place of work several hours.

This is the to start with revision in retail selling prices of petrol and diesel given that late May perhaps, when the federal authorities slice taxes on the two fuels to defend consumers from substantial world wide price ranges and rein in inflation.
